Geçen gün kahve içerken, teknoloji dünyasının bazen ne kadar kaotik olabileceği bir kez daha ortaya çıktı. Özellikle de programlama dili Zig gibi eski eller aniden GitHub'a sırtlarını dönmeye karar verdiklerinde. Elbette kendinize soruyorsunuz: bu drama neden? Perde arkasında pek çok şey oluyor ve bunların başlıcaları GitHub Actions ile ilgili sinir bozucu deneyimler, daha çok bir karmaşa olan iş planlaması ve Microsoft'un yapay zeka yönelimiyle ilgili. Kulağa isyan gibi geliyor, ancak Zig'e bahis yapan geliştiriciler için gerçek bu. Gelin, Zig'in GitHub'dan ayrılışının nedenlerine, arka planına ve gelecek için ne anlama geldiğine bakarak bir tur atalım.
Zig için büyük son: Programlama dili on yıl sonra neden GitHub'dan ayrılıyor?
Zig gibi maksimum kontrol ve verimlilik için inek bir programa sahip olan bir programlama dilinin on yıl sonra kaçacağını kim düşünebilirdi? Neredeyse kötü bir ilişkinin sona ermesi gibi - ancak burada ortak proje kaynak kodu üzerinde kimin kontrol sahibi olduğudur. Zig, topluluğunu güçlendirmek için GitHub'ı kullandı, ancak hayal kırıklığı artıyor: iş planlamasıyla ilgili sorunlar, eylemlerle ilgili şeffaflık eksikliği ve birçok geliştiricinin şüpheyle yaklaştığı bir Microsoft stratejisi. Tüm bunlar kulağa açık projeler için öldürücü bir belirleyici gibi geliyor. Ama tam olarak ne oldu? Gelin buna ayrıntılı olarak bir göz atalım.
GitHub Actions - Şüphe altındaki kaotik iş planlaması
GitHub Actions'ın geliştiricilerin hayatını kolaylaştırması gerekiyor - otomatik derlemeler, testler, dağıtım. Peki ya bu araç daha çok tek tekerlekli bisiklete binmiş bir sirke benziyorsa? Zig geliştiricilerinin şikayetçi olduğu şey tam olarak bu. Açıkça yapılandırılmış süreçler yerine kaos, sürekli bekleme ve hatalı dağıtım günlükleri var. İş zamanlaması planlı olmaktan çok rastlantısal. İstikrar ve verimliliği vurgulayan bir programlama dili için bu durum doğal olarak pek de heyecan verici değil. Zig'in şimdi başını kaldırıp "Güle güle GitHub, biz yokuz" demesine şaşmamalı.
Microsoft'un yapay zeka yönelimi - Açık projeler için caydırıcı faktör
Microsoft yapay zeka konusunda tamamen kararlı - ki bu kendi içinde harika, ancak genellikle açık kaynak topluluğu pahasına. Zig gibi açık, şeffaf araçlara güvenen geliştiriciler, Microsoft tarafından gölgede bırakıldıklarını hissediyorlar. Bu, birbirlerine yeni aşık olmuş bir çiftin tartışmasını izlemeye benziyor: Biri yapay zekaya odaklanmak isterken, diğeri kanıtlanmış, bağımsız teknolojilere tutunuyor. Zig için bu sonuçta şu anlama geliyordu Daha az destek, daha az öncelik. Bu da hayal kırıklığının artmasına ve nihayetinde hendekten ayrılma kararına yol açtı.
Geliştirici topluluğu üzerindeki etkisi
Topluluk için bu daha fazla belirsizlik, platforma daha az güven ve daha az açık işbirliği anlamına geliyor. Zig'in GitHub ekosisteminden çıkarılması, güvenilirlik ve bağımsızlığa güvenen geliştiriciler için bir kayıp gibi geliyor. Bu, yeni kahvenin tadı olmadığı için kahve satıcınızı değiştirmek gibi bir şey. Birçokları için GitHub uzun zamandır sadece bir kod barındırıcı olmaktan öte, açık işbirliğinin sembolü olmuştur. Zig'in ayrılması şu soruyu gündeme getiriyor: GitHub yeniden herkes için daha güvenli hale mi geliyor, yoksa bu sadece şirketler ve topluluk arasındaki dengenin ne kadar kırılgan olduğunu mu gösteriyor?
Bu, Nvidia'nın Synopsys hisselerini satın alması için ne anlama geliyor?
Bir dakika, tüm bunlar Nvidia'nın Synopsys hisselerini satın alması konusuyla nasıl bağdaşıyor? Basitçe söylemek gerekirse, teknoloji dünyasında bir platformun sürdürülebilirliği ve büyük oyuncuların desteği çok önemlidir. Eğer geliştiriciler bir platformdaki projelerini kaybetmekten korkuyorsa, bu yatırımcıların dikkatli olması gerektiği anlamına gelir. Güçlü yapay zeka yatırımları olan Nvidia, inovasyonu teşvik etmek için Synopsys gibi istikrarlı ve güvenilir ortaklara ihtiyaç duyuyor. GitHub'ın şimdiye kadar sağladığı gibi istikrarlı bir altyapı olmadan teknolojik gelişim durabilir. Bu nedenle, ister hisselere yatırım yapmak ister geleceği şekillendirecek araçları seçmek olsun, doğru ortakları seçmek çok önemlidir.
Açık kaynak projeleri için gelecek ne getirebilir?
Teknoloji ekosistemindeki boşanma dalgası gibi: büyük bir programlama dili ya da platformu kendini uzaklaştırdığında, geliştiriciler hızla alternatifler arıyor. Belki de bu durum daha fazla çeşitliliğe ve hatta yeni, bağımsız platformların sahneye çıkmasına yol açacaktır. Synopsys'i satın alan Nvidia için bir şey çok açık: açık kaynak topluluklarına veda edilirse, önemli yenilikler kaybedilebilir. Bu nedenle büyük oyuncular istikrarlı ve güvene dayalı ortaklıklara güveniyor - tıpkı Nvidia'nın Synopsys ile yaptığı gibi. Bu, yalnızca yapay zeka gibi trend konulara değil, aynı zamanda istikrar ve değerlere de odaklanan geleceğe dönük teknolojilere ve platformlara yatırım yapmak anlamına geliyor.
Zig'in ayrılması geliştiriciler için ne anlama geliyor?
Topluluk için bu, tanıdık bir dile veya platforma veda etmenin asla hoş olmadığı anlamına gelir. Ancak aynı zamanda yeni bir şey için alan açıyor. Belki de artık GitHub'dan bağımsız olarak çalışan ve daha fazla kontrol sunan yenilikçi projeler ortaya çıkacaktır. Synopsys'i satın alan Nvidia için bu, şirketler tarafından ele geçirilemeyen gelecek vaat eden teknolojilere odaklanmak için bir fırsat. Dürüst olmak gerekirse: Her şey neredeyse bir büyüme aşaması gibi - esnek kalanlar daha güçlü çıkacaktır.
